Aleksander Morgado wrote:
> Hey,
>
> I think I solved the issues, lets see. Basically, some libs where not
> being checked at configure time (libpcre, libGLU, and libCg) so I didn't
> actually consider them (would be a good idea to check for them in
> configure time).
>
They should not be checked in configure. Those are not Psychosynth deps,
they are Ogre and Cegui dependencies but Andrew Finn packages do not
include them as dependencies. I do not know if mixing Debian Sid and
Ubuntu repos is problematic, but Debian Sid now includes the latest Ogre.
> Also, Andrew Finn's PPA is also needed to get latest ogre. The
> sources.list, then, should include:
>
> # Andrew Finn's PPA for ogre16 and friends
> deb http://ppa.launchpad.net/andrewfenn/ppa/ubuntu jaunty main
> deb-src http://ppa.launchpad.net/andrewfenn/ppa/ubuntu jaunty main
>
> # Aleksander Morgado's PPA for Psychosynth
> deb http://ppa.launchpad.net/aleksander-m/psychosynth/ubuntu jaunty main
> deb-src http://ppa.launchpad.net/aleksander-m/psychosynth/ubuntu jaunty
> main
>

>>>> Aleksander Morgado wrote:
>>>>> Hey there,
>>>>>
>>>>> I uploaded the psychosynth debian package info to my launchpad
>>>>> account, and hopefully the packages will be soon automatically
>>>>> generated (they are already in the building queue in launchpad).
>>>>>
>>>>> Just add these lines to your sources.list and apt-get update.
>>>>>
>>>>> # My PPA for Psychosynth
>>>>> deb http://ppa.launchpad.net/aleksander-m/psychosynth/ubuntu jaunty
>>>>> main
>>>>> deb-src http://ppa.launchpad.net/aleksander-m/psychosynth/ubuntu
>>>>> jaunty main
>>>>>
>>>>> I created 4 packages, based on how the project was split in the Suse
>>>>> RPM packages:
>>>>> * libpsynth0
>>>>> * psychosynth (cli)
>>>>> * psychosynth-gui (3d desktop gui)
>>>>> * psychosynth-samples (the sample .ogg files)
>>>>>
>>>>> I really didn't make many tests, just on my machine, so would be great
>>>>> if someone else could test it in Ubuntu (jaunty 9.04 only), before
>>>>> saying they're fully ready.
